I am trying to share a dashboard to the group/project.
I am going to the dashboard's "share"/"Edit" option and sharing it with a group/project.
After updating the information, it doesn't work.
When I search for the dashboard, it doesn't show that it has been shared with someone

Hi @[deleted]
Did you click on the add button after you selected the group ? you have to do this and after run the update.
Regards
@[deleted]
What Mohamed said ^.
Also, remember to share the filters with the intended audience.

Hello @[deleted] @Mohamed Benziane ,
I am also facing similar issue, After clicking Add project, unable to save it. Do we need any specific access to share the Dashboard ?
You must be a registered user to add a comment. If you've already registered, sign in. Otherwise, register and sign in.
Make sure you have the create shared object global permission.
